Output f4c23651543f852ad428a2951585839cfa824cc289752888a564747f11694fe5:1

value
31672596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66aeabfe934370f5a0fbca728b95b14b8f8b8f2 OP_EQUAL
address
3JKYzBNazB2WtRZaiYAMMkLrskreo8FDFP
transaction
f4c23651543f852ad428a2951585839cfa824cc289752888a564747f11694fe5
spent
true